Chief Minister Bhupesh Baghel today participated in the virtual program of swearing-in of the newly elected office bearers of the Bharat Scouts and Guides Chhattisgarh State Council. He administered the oath to the office bearers through video conferencing from his residence office. The Chief Minister congratulated and congratulated all the newly elected office bearers for successfully discharging their responsibilities.

The Chief Minister told the office-bearers that you have taken the responsibility of taking forward such a global movement in Chhattisgarh, which was started by Lord Wedden Powell in Britain in 1907. Scouting is a movement of character building of the individual, which inculcates human values ​​in children. One of the important principles of Scouting is the principle that a Scout is a friend of all. Every Scout is the brother of another Scout. In this way, this principle links Scouting to universal brotherhood. Humility, loyalty and reliability are the qualities of every Scout. This movement teaches a person to love nature. It teaches that this world is full of animals and birds. It is our responsibility to preserve them.

The Chief Minister said that Scouting teaches to be frugal. Purity of thought, word and deed is the first condition of Scouting. A Scout is always ready with body and mind to serve others. According to the tradition of Scouting, every Scout puts a knot on his scarp and vows not to untie the knot until he has completed the service.

Scouting is a movement of world-society building, which India is also taking forward. This movement in India had started even before independence. The ‘Bharat Scouts and Guides’ in independent India was established on 7 November 1950 by Pandit Jawaharlal Nehru, Maulana Abul Kalam Azad and Mangal Das Pakwasa.
